142  Smiley Smile Stuff / General On Topic Discussions / Re: The DJ's on: January 30, 2014, 05:41:51 PM
Comments on Groovy photos.. Ah Memories !  You have jogged my memory.. I thought beach stuff was for 2 years but after lookin at date on KHJ survey I realized it was 1 year but 2 summers..  That KHJ top 30 survey is dated 3-22-67.. NGDB did Buy For Me The Rain on a sand dune winter spring 1967 .. WE used to go to Santa Monica every weekend and I learned how to surf there .. We would get there 7am and surf till 10am .. Then surfin wasn't allowed except near the pier.. KHJ would come down and film there and sometimes during the week in summer also.. it was a very popular show and you mentioned games they played.. One was human pyramids in the sand which I participated in many times.. Great fun + a little dangerous..! Bands played on Sand Dunes back away from the water  but they would make the crowd stay back where Michael Blodgett was....  NGDB.. Bob Lind.. Standells.. Allman joys.. Roy Head.. The Byrds  Tommy Roe.. Seeds.. Most of the artists on 9th st west + Hollywood ago go.. did the beach thing.. After the show went inside less guests more music videos..  When I was on that show in the back ground on the beach I was in 9th grade + 10th grade.. Question tho to Guitar Fool.. Are those pics of the KHJ truck and beach flocked..?? Turned around.. Groovy show was filmed on the south side of the pier.. Your pics show north side of the pier.. Groovy show was filmed south side of pier same area known as muscle beach.. Still in Santa Monica.. Muscle Beach was an area near the board walk where they weight lifted .. Gym equipment.. Volley ball nets.. wrestling   mats..  Also the large building in the back I think.. Is the old merry go round..
143  Smiley Smile Stuff / General On Topic Discussions / Re: The DJ's on: January 30, 2014, 05:07:30 PM
This stuff is more along the lines of DJ thread.. That Top 30 chart was awesome to see and jogged memories.. Back in those days I knew NOTHING about Billboard + Cash box charts etc.. To us  KHJ charts were it.. So if it was a hit here it was a hit everywhere In USA.. Well that's not always the case I learned later.. Or maybe it didn't chart as high somewhere else.. KHJ and our little transistor radio's + buying 45rpm singles is what we all bought to learn songs to play in our little bands..  KHJ was really hip and played songs that were not getting airplay elsewhere.. Case in point.. Little Black Egg The Night  Crawlers.. If you had a little band you played that song.. REQUIRED.. Another one Hey Joe The Leaves.. Big hit out here and everyone played it.. Hendrix came out with his 2 years later and we thought he ruined the song. Shocked Listen to intro of Byrds  Feel A Whole Lot Better.. Almost exact same intro as Leaves Hey Joe.. That KHJ top 30 survey has a lot of hip things that didn't hit big nationally . The Merry Go Round.. Yellow Balloon The Seeds.. NGDB..  Great stuff..!!  I know it helped to be in the center of the Music Bussiness.. Back then AM wasn't conservative ..And the DJ's were all stars.. And it was nice to see Charlie Tuna with real hair in that pic.. A life long BB supporter ..

149  Smiley Smile Stuff / General On Topic Discussions / Re: The DJ's on: January 27, 2014, 04:37:43 PM
Yea B. Mitchell Reed In Southern California.. He went from AM to FM and went to KPPC Pasadena ca.. The 1st rock station on FM dial out here.. Then he went to KMET and his knick name was The Beamer on radio.. He was one of those jocks that got REAL close to the musicians and hung out + partied with them.. CSNY in particular.. He used to play LONG cuts on the radio..!! But he died young like in his late 50's I think.. He was famous out here.!
